$2K Donation Gives Major Boost to Singing Bishop’s Feeding Program
NASSAU, BAHAMAS – Christmas came early for International Deliverance Praying Ministry, and its well-known senior pastor, “Singing Bishop” Lawrence Rolle. The church recently got a $2,000 donation thanks to a joint partnership between Bahamas Power and Light and the Bahamas Electrical Utility Managerial Union.
